Abstract :
The recent years, we have observed a growing demand for biometrics to authenticate users. Compared to other designs, such as using passwords and pins, biometric-based authentication systems face new and different challenges; however, most of them guarantee the users’ biometric privacy in backends, as these data must be provided for a lifetime of a person. However, most of them need a trusted server. Cryptographic approaches such as multi-party computation have improved the privacy of private data without trusting a server. A secure multi-party sum is one of the most important secure multi-party computation protocols to protect users’ privacy. This paper introduces a blockchain-based user re-enrollment for biometric-based authentication schemes using a secure multi-party sum protocol. Blockchain technology has dismissed the need for a trusted server. The proposed scheme uses Shamir’s secret sharing, ElGamal encryption, and Schnorr’s digital signature to compute the secret biometric shares. In our scheme, it is possible to securely re-enrollment users without their physical presence. In addition, comparative evaluations indicate the efficiency and security of the proposed scheme
